Why Gold-Filled, Not Plated
The accent beads are 14K gold-filled, not plated. Gold-filled contains 100 times more gold than plated and is pressure-bonded at the core. It will not flake, fade, or turn. The warm gold tone ties directly to the warmth in the scarlet tourmaline, creating a palette that is rich, cohesive, and built to last.
THE DETAILS
Stone: Natural scarlet tourmaline rondells
Pearl: Freshwater oval pearls, organic and unique
Metal: 14K gold-filled accent beads and clasp hardware
Length: 16 inches, collarbone length, 2" extender
Finish: High-polish rondells, lustrous pearl surface
Edition: One of a kind. There is exactly one.
